9 | generic class GenLocateExtPC from Extrema |
10 | (Curve as any; |
11 | Tool as any; -- as ToolCurve(Curve); |
12 | POnC as any; |
13 | Pnt as any; |
14 | Vec as any ) |
15 | |
16 | ---Purpose: It calculates the distance between a point and a |
17 | -- curve with a close point. |
18 | -- This distance can be a minimum or a maximum. |
19 | |
20 | |
21 | raises DomainError from Standard, |
22 | TypeMismatch from Standard, |
23 | NotDone from StdFail |
24 | |
25 | private class PCLocF instantiates FuncExtPC (Curve, Tool, POnC, Pnt, Vec); |
26 | |
27 | is |
28 | Create returns GenLocateExtPC; |
29 | |
30 | Create (P: Pnt; C: Curve; U0: Real; TolU: Real) |
31 | returns GenLocateExtPC |
32 | ---Purpose: Calculates the distance with a close point. |
33 | -- The close point is defined by the parameter value |
34 | -- U0. |
35 | -- The function F(u)=distance(P,C(u)) has an extremum |
36 | -- when g(u)=dF/du=0. The algorithm searchs a zero |
37 | -- near the close point. |
38 | -- TolU is used to decide to stop the iterations. |
39 | -- At the nth iteration, the criteria is: |
40 | -- abs(Un - Un-1) < TolU. |
41 | raises DomainError; |
42 | -- if U0 is outside the definition range of the curve. |
43 | |
44 | |
45 | Create (P: Pnt; C: Curve; U0: Real; Umin, Usup: Real; TolU: Real) |
46 | returns GenLocateExtPC |
47 | ---Purpose: Calculates the distance with a close point. |
48 | -- The close point is defined by the parameter value |
49 | -- U0. |
50 | -- The function F(u)=distance(P,C(u)) has an extremum |
51 | -- when g(u)=dF/du=0. The algorithm searchs a zero |
52 | -- near the close point. |
53 | -- Zeros are searched between Umin et Usup. |
54 | -- TolU is used to decide to stop the iterations. |
55 | -- At the nth iteration, the criteria is: |
56 | -- abs(Un - Un-1) < TolU. |
57 | raises DomainError; |
58 | -- if U0 is outside the definition range of the curve. |
